Motorworks Brewing (Bradenton, Florida) has officially announced that it will begin the Limited Bottle Release for Therianthropy American Wild Ale on Wednesday, August 7.
Born purely out of curiosity, Therianthropy came about when the brewers at Motorworks wanted to see how the souring bacteria from La Couronne Sauvage – the brewery’s “first foray into the world of mixed culture beer” – . . . would assert itself in a small batch of Scottish Ale (the base beer for [the brewery’s] Lavender Ale that was yet to be dosed).” After inoculation and aging for several months, the beer emerged from its barrels boasting “tart, fruity flavors evocative of dried stone fruit that wonderfully complement its smooth, sweet malt base, building a flavor profile not unlike a Flanders Red Ale.”
Therianthropy will debut in Motorworks Brewing’s Taproom (1014 9th Street West | Bradenton, Florida) on August 7 and will stick around only as long as supplies last. This Limited Release offering will be available in 750ml bottles for the price of $18 each. Therianthropy is a Taproom exclusive release that will not see distribution. Prost!
Vital Information for Therianthropy from Motorworks Brewing
Release – Limited; August 7, 2019
Style – American Wild Ale
ABV – 6%
Treatment – A Scottish Ale inoculated with the brewery’s mixed culture & aged for months in oak barrels
Availability – 750ml bottles
Distribution – None. Taproom only
